The Limitations of Cloud-Only AI Chat Storage
While convenient, the default cloud-based storage of AI chat platforms comes with several inherent limitations that can impact your workflow and data security.
- ▸Internet Dependency: This is the most obvious drawback. No internet means no access to your chat history. For professionals on the go, students in remote areas, or anyone experiencing a network outage, this can be a major productivity killer.
- ▸Data Privacy Concerns: Storing sensitive information or proprietary data in the cloud, even with reputable providers, always carries a degree of risk. Local storage keeps your data entirely within your control, on your own device.
- ▸Vendor Lock-in: Your chat history is tied to the specific platform. If you decide to switch AI models or if a service changes its terms, migrating your data can be cumbersome or even impossible without proper export tools.
- ▸Limited Export Options: Many platforms offer basic copy-paste functionality, but comprehensive, structured exports suitable for long-term archiving or integration with other tools are often lacking or require manual effort.
These limitations highlight the need for a more robust, user-centric approach to managing your AI conversations.

Choosing the Right Local Storage Format
When saving your AI chats locally, the format you choose significantly impacts usability, longevity, and integration with other tools. Consider these popular options:
- ▸PDF (Portable Document Format): Ideal for archiving and sharing. PDFs preserve formatting and are universally viewable, making them excellent for reports or final documents. They are generally not easily editable.
- ▸Markdown (.md): A lightweight markup language that's human-readable and easily convertible to other formats (HTML, PDF, etc.). Perfect for notes, documentation, and integration with knowledge bases like Obsidian or Notion. It's highly editable and future-proof.
- ▸DOCX (Microsoft Word Document): Best for documents that require extensive editing, collaboration, or specific formatting for professional reports. Widely supported by word processors.
- ▸Plain Text (.txt): The simplest format, offering maximum compatibility but no formatting. Good for raw data or quick snippets.
- ▸JSON (.json): Structured data format, excellent for programmatic access, data analysis, or integration with databases. Not human-readable in its raw form.
For most users looking to access AI chats offline and integrate them into a knowledge management system, Markdown is often the superior choice due to its flexibility and readability.
